Chapter 44: Father and daughter kowtow to support)

At night, I was still lying on the sofa, holding my head in my hands and pillowing it behind my head, looking at the roof with the moonlight coming through the window.

Dong Li's only value is that he is from Zhengyang Police Station, and he has more or less information about the Police Department, but it is very limited.

If you put it this way, is Dong Li considered an anti-Manchurian and anti-Japanese element?

But it doesn't look like it. The fact of smoking cigarettes looks like someone is using it to control Dong Li. Dong Li does not look like an anti-Manchu anti-Japanese element, but seems to be threatened.

If the anti-Manchurian and anti-Japanese elements threatened Dong Li and asked him to work for them, then why did Chen Xiqiao still pay attention to Dong Li?

There was nothing interesting to see on the roof. Yu Jingque's eyes slowly turned to the bed, where her jade body was delicate and graceful.

"Hey, are you asleep?" Yu Jingque asked.

"Sleep."

"Can you still answer when you're asleep?"

"Then what are you asking? I was woken up by you even when I was sleeping." Ji Youning opened his eyes and looked at Yu Jingque on the sofa. In the darkness, both of them could only see each other's outline.

Yu Jingque said with a playful smile: "I can't sleep, so I want to chat with you."

"Don't you look down on us?" Ji Youning felt that the sun was coming out from the west, and Yu Jingque actually wanted to talk to him.

"It's just a joke, but it can't be taken seriously." Yu Jingque said shamelessly.

Perhaps Ji Youning was very satisfied with Yu Jingque's attitude of admitting his mistake. She changed her position on the bed, lying on her side and looking at Yu Jingque.

"What do you want to talk about?" Ji Youning asked in a low voice.

"Do you mind if we talk about your father's smoking?" Yu Jingque's words made Ji Youning want to turn his back on him, but there was no hint of ridicule in Yu Jingque's words, so he calmed down.

"Smoking big cigarettes is nothing to talk about, it's a harmful thing." Ji Youning said.

Yu Jingque half sat up from the sofa and said, "The end justifies the means?"

"When you get addicted to smoking, you don't just do whatever it takes..." Ji Youning obviously doesn't want to have more memories.

Dong Li smoked heavily and had no money. He was controlled by others later and seemed to be very organized.

But Dong Li can't provide more help, so why would someone pay a huge price to raise it? Is this common sense?

Is there any unknown secret behind Dong Li?

Yu Jingque believed that there was no such thing. If there was, it would be impossible for him to discover nothing in a few years.

Dong Li's character was an anti-Manchurian and anti-Japanese element. It was not because Yu Jingque looked down on him, but he was not the material.

Check?

As a member of the Zhengyang Police Station, it is only natural to investigate a person whom I suspect.

As for whether Dong Li and Yu Jingque are friends?

That is also relative, as the old saying goes, if something happens to Yu Jingque, Dong Li will be the first to add insult to injury, and everyone knows it.

Chen Xiqiao only asked himself to pay attention to Dong Li, but did not ask him to investigate. What would he do if something bad happened? Chen Xiqiao was afraid that Chen Xiqiao would say that he was nosy.

"Why didn't you speak?" Ji Youning was anxious when he saw Yu Jingque didn't speak.

"No, I was just wondering what the smoke tastes like." Yu Jingque said with a smile.

These words made Ji Youning suddenly sit up from the bed, looked at Yu Jingque on the sofa and said, "You must never do anything stupid."

"Care about me?" Seeing Ji Youning's worried look, Yu Jingque laughed heartlessly.

Although Yu Jingque's laughter is very pleasant, from just now to now, it's basically like laughing.

But when it came to the big smoke issue, Ji Youning would not back down. She said, "Don't try it, don't even think about it, or I'll tell your father."

"Is it okay to file a complaint?" Yu Jingque said depressed.

"I'm serious." Ji Youning did not make any jokes with Yu Jingque about this matter.

"Okay, okay, I promise you, what about that?" Yu Jingque said seriously.

Seeing Yu Jingque put away his smile, Ji Youning believed Yu Jingque's words.

Ji Youning lay on the bed again, just like Yu Jingque did at the beginning, looking at the roof and muttering to himself: "I don't want to experience that feeling again."

"What does it feel like?" Yu Jingque asked.

"He is not like my father, like a stranger. In order to smoke a big cigarette, he actually knelt down and kowtowed to me."

"I knelt on the ground, and my father and I were kowtowing to each other. I begged him not to smoke, and he begged me to give him a puff."

Ji Youning's tone was neither sad nor happy. Maybe the sadness dissipated the moment she knelt down.

"Both of them had bloody foreheads on the ground. When he saw that I still didn't agree, he got up in anger and kicked me. I knelt on the ground and didn't move. After being kicked down, I continued to kneel."

"He...kicked me and it didn't hurt. He was soft and soft, as if he felt sorry for me. In fact, he was a walking zombie, skinny and bones, and not human at all."

"In the end, he secretly took another puff. His little wife gave it to him because she wanted him to die so that he could take away the family property and leave."

Yu Jingque asked: "Did you let her go?"

"Walk?"

"No, I used my last bit of money to give it to the people at the Fengtian Police Department and sent her to prison." Ji Youning's words were something Yu Jingque did not expect. Yu Jingque thought Ji Youning would let her go.

"What's wrong, are you surprised?" Ji Youning asked with a smile.

Yu Jingque nodded and said: "A little bit."

"So don't mess with me, I'm not easy to mess with." Ji Youning rarely made a joke.

"What happens next?" Yu Jingque realized this evening that he didn't seem to know Ji Youning at all.

Ji Youning laughed self-deprecatingly and said, "Have you been to the mourning hall?"

In these troubled times and disaster years, dead people are commonplace, and some of them have a good relationship with Yu Mosheng.

Yu Mosheng went where Yu Mosheng could go, and where Yu Mosheng couldn't go, Yu Jingque also went there several times on his behalf. In the past two years, he was really no stranger to the mourning hall.

"Then you have seen that in the mourning hall, there is no worship, no incense burning, no family members paying tribute, and no mourning."

"Is there just a group of creditors who gather around coffins to collect debts?" Ji Youning's words did not seem to be about something she had personally experienced. She seemed to be a bystander, watching a scene with a cold eye.

Looking at Ji Youning on the bed, Yu Jingque discovered for the first time that she seemed not as fragile as he thought, she was...stronger.

"No wonder you were so excited just now." Yu Jingque said.

"I don't want to wear sackcloth and mourn again." Yu Jingque was not angry at Ji Youning's words.

Yu Jingque suddenly thought of something.

"A woman should be pretty and filial."

I don’t know what kind of style Ji Youning looks like when he puts on mourning clothes.

"Don't worry, no one will come out to ask for debts at the mourning hall." Yu Jingque's joke was as cold as the current weather in Bingcheng.

Seeing that Ji Youning didn't answer, Yu Jingque said slightly embarrassed: "Besides, you have to leave sooner or later. When the time comes, we will make peace with each other. It's not your responsibility to wear sackcloth and mourning."

"Promise me not to touch this thing even if I leave." Ji Youning's voice was filled with a hint of begging.

Begging?

Yu Jingque was surprised. It seemed that this incident had a great impact on Ji Youning.

"I promise you I won't touch him for the rest of my life." Yu Jingque had no intention of touching him at first, but now he could naturally promise Ji Youning.

Perhaps Ji Youning was very satisfied with Yu Jingque's answer, so he didn't speak anymore and fell asleep.
